        Along the top right of the New Post & Edit pages it has:
        *Switch to draft
        *Preview
        *Schedule
        *The Settings wheel
        *The Jetpack symbol
        *Then 3 dots

        Click on the dots
        .
        .
        .
        This will drop a column with:
        Editor
        Plugins
        Tools
        Manage all reusable blocks
        Help
        *Switch to Classic Editor
